Urbanisation Dynamics and Socio-Spatial Transformation: Evidence from Samarkand, Uzbekistan
Abstract Urbanisation in post-Soviet Central Asia has accelerated significantly over recent decades, reshaping demographic structures, land use patterns and socio-economic development trajectories across the region. Considerable attention has been paid to the capital city of Tashkent, whereas the urbanisation dynamics of secondary cities and their surrounding regions remain insufficiently explored in the academic literature.
